•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/netgear-WNDR4500v2-V1.0.0.60_1.0.38/src/linux/linux-2.6/drivers/scsi/lpfc/

Lines Matching defs:pmb

68 	LPFC_MBOXQ_t *pmb;
76 pmb = mempool_alloc(phba->mbox_mem_pool, GFP_KERNEL);
77 if (!pmb) {
82 mb = &pmb->mb;
94 lpfc_read_nv(phba, pmb);
100 rc = lpfc_sli_issue_mbox(phba, pmb, MBX_POLL);
111 mempool_free(pmb, phba->mbox_mem_pool);
119 lpfc_read_rev(phba, pmb);
120 rc = lpfc_sli_issue_mbox(phba, pmb, MBX_POLL);
129 mempool_free( pmb, phba->mbox_mem_pool);
143 mempool_free(pmb, phba->mbox_mem_pool);
169 pmb->context2 = kmalloc(DMP_RSP_SIZE, GFP_KERNEL);
170 if (!pmb->context2)
177 lpfc_dump_mem(phba, pmb, offset);
178 rc = lpfc_sli_issue_mbox(phba, pmb, MBX_POLL);
190 lpfc_sli_pcimem_bcopy(pmb->context2, lpfc_vpd_data + offset,
198 kfree(pmb->context2);
200 mempool_free(pmb, phba->mbox_mem_pool);
217 LPFC_MBOXQ_t *pmb;
224 pmb = mempool_alloc(phba->mbox_mem_pool, GFP_KERNEL);
225 if (!pmb) {
229 mb = &pmb->mb;
231 lpfc_config_link(phba, pmb);
232 rc = lpfc_sli_issue_mbox(phba, pmb, MBX_POLL);
242 mempool_free( pmb, phba->mbox_mem_pool);
247 lpfc_read_sparam(phba, pmb);
248 if (lpfc_sli_issue_mbox(phba, pmb, MBX_POLL) != MBX_SUCCESS) {
257 mp = (struct lpfc_dmabuf *) pmb->context1;
258 mempool_free( pmb, phba->mbox_mem_pool);
264 mp = (struct lpfc_dmabuf *) pmb->context1;
269 pmb->context1 = NULL;
305 lpfc_read_config(phba, pmb);
306 if (lpfc_sli_issue_mbox(phba, pmb, MBX_POLL) != MBX_SUCCESS) {
315 mempool_free( pmb, phba->mbox_mem_pool);
391 lpfc_init_link(phba, pmb, phba->cfg_topology, phba->cfg_link_speed);
392 pmb->mbox_cmpl = lpfc_sli_def_mbox_cmpl;
393 rc = lpfc_sli_issue_mbox(phba, pmb, MBX_NOWAIT);
413 mempool_free(pmb, phba->mbox_mem_pool);
572 LPFC_MBOXQ_t *pmb;
577 pmb = (LPFC_MBOXQ_t *)mempool_alloc(phba->mbox_mem_pool, GFP_KERNEL);
578 if (!pmb)
595 lpfc_read_la(phba, pmb, mp);
596 pmb->mbox_cmpl = lpfc_mbx_cmpl_read_la;
597 rc = lpfc_sli_issue_mbox (phba, pmb, (MBX_NOWAIT | MBX_STOP_IOCB));
614 mempool_free(pmb, phba->mbox_mem_pool);